How they compare
Ecuador currently reports 3.3 against 3.04 in Netherlands, a difference of 0.26.
That makes Ecuador's figure about 1.1 times Netherlands's.
The two have swapped places 23 times across 56 shared years of data; in 1966 it was Netherlands ahead.
Ecuador ranks 29th and Netherlands ranks 31st of 110 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, Ecuador averaged higher in 4 and Netherlands in 3.
